Your Role as Early Years Assistant Manager:

In this key leadership role, you will:

  • Work collaboratively with the nursery management team to inspire and lead staff in delivering high-quality, inclusive early years education and care.
  • Act as a role model, demonstrating sensitive and responsive interactions to extend children's learning experiences.
  • Ensure quality and safety standards are consistently met and maintained.

What We’re Looking For:

  • Minimum Level 3 qualification in Early Years Education and Childcare (or equivalent).
  • Post-qualification experience in early education, childcare, or a similar environment.
  • Strong written communication skills, including the ability to produce clear reports, child protection/safeguarding documentation, and business correspondence.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Word and other computer tools for report writing and administrative tasks.
  • Leadership abilities – the capability to inspire, motivate, and set high standards for both yourself and your team.
  • An enhanced DBS check (if your current certificate is not subscribed to the update service).
